Binance Launches USD-Margined Perpetual Contracts for HMSTR and CATI
In a pivotal update released on September 16, Binance announced the upcoming launch of USD-Margined perpetual contracts for CATIUSDT and HMSTRUSDT, marking a significant milestone for both projects. According to the official statement:
- Catizen (CATI) perpetual futures will go live on September 20 at 10:30 UTC.
- Hamster Kombat (HMSTR) futures will follow on September 26 at 12:30 UTC.
Both contracts will support up to 75x leverage, offering traders enhanced flexibility and profit potential. The funding rate caps are set at +2.00% / -2.00%, although the tick size remains unconfirmed. These specifications may be adjusted by Binance depending on evolving market risk conditions, including changes to funding fees, margin requirements, or maximum leverage.

Growing Momentum Behind Telegram-Based P2E Games
The rise of Hamster Kombat and Catizen reflects a broader trend: the resurgence of blockchain-powered mini-games on messaging platforms, particularly Telegram. These games combine casual gameplay with tokenized rewards, attracting millions of users who engage daily to earn crypto through simple, addictive mechanics.
Binance’s decision to list perpetual contracts for HMSTR and CATI follows earlier strategic moves that already positioned these tokens for success:
- Hamster Kombat (HMSTR) was named Binance’s 58th Launchpool project, allowing users to stake existing assets to farm HMSTR tokens.
- Catizen (CATI) quickly followed as the 59th Launchpool addition, further cementing Binance’s confidence in the Telegram gaming ecosystem.
These integrations don’t just offer exposure—they provide liquidity, credibility, and access to one of the largest trader bases in the world. Why Futures Listings Matter for Emerging Tokens
Futures contracts play a crucial role in maturing a cryptocurrency’s market structure. Here’s why this development matters:
- Increased Liquidity: Futures markets attract institutional and high-frequency traders, boosting overall trading volume.
- Price Discovery: Derivatives enable more accurate pricing based on supply, demand, and sentiment.
- Hedging Opportunities: Investors can hedge spot positions against downside risk using short futures.
- Speculative Leverage: Up to 75x leverage allows traders to amplify gains (and risks), increasing market participation.
For HMSTR and CATI, this means stronger price visibility, improved market depth, and greater resilience against volatility over time.

What are USD-Margined perpetual contracts?
USD-Margined perpetual contracts allow traders to speculate on cryptocurrency prices using USDT or other stablecoins as collateral. Unlike traditional futures, they have no expiry date and use a funding rate mechanism to keep prices aligned with the spot market.

How do Launchpool projects benefit from Binance listings?
Being selected for Binance Launchpool gives new projects immediate visibility, user acquisition, and token distribution through staking campaigns. It often precedes further listings like spot trading or futures, creating a roadmap for sustained growth.
Are there risks involved in trading leveraged futures?
Yes. While high leverage increases profit potential, it also magnifies losses. Traders should use stop-loss orders, understand margin requirements, and avoid overexposure—especially during volatile market events.
Why are Telegram-based games gaining traction in crypto?
Telegram offers a massive built-in user base, low development barriers, and seamless integration with Web3 wallets. Games like Hamster Kombat and Catizen leverage this ecosystem to onboard non-crypto natives through fun, accessible gameplay tied to real economic incentives.
